Understanding the Instagram Ecosystem

Before diving into specific ideas, you must understand how Instagram functions today. It is no longer just a photo-sharing app. It is a multi-format platform consisting of Feed posts (Static and Carousels), Stories, Reels, and Live broadcasts. Each format serves a different purpose in your social media engagement funnel.

Instagram Reels are designed for discovery and reaching new audiences. Instagram Stories are for nurturing your existing community and showing your personality. Feed posts (especially Carousels) are excellent for providing deep value and establishing authority. To succeed, your brand aesthetic must be cohesive across all these touchpoints.

Phase 1: Laying the Foundation for Success

Before you post your first piece of creative content, your profile must be ready to convert visitors into followers. This is often referred to as Instagram bio optimization. Your bio should clearly state who you are, what you do, and what value you provide to the follower.

  • Professional Profile Picture: Use a high-quality headshot or a recognizable brand logo.
  • Keyword-Optimized Name: Include your niche in your name field (e.g., “Jane Doe | Fitness Coach”).
  • Compelling Bio: Use bullet points to describe your unique selling proposition (USP).
  • Call to Action (CTA): Direct users to a link, whether it is your website, a newsletter, or a digital product.

Phase 2: 20+ Creative Instagram Content Ideas for Beginners

Generating fresh ideas every day is challenging. To help you maintain consistency, we have categorized these ideas into four main pillars: Educational, Inspirational, Entertaining, and Promotional.

1. The “Educational” Content Pillar

Educational content positions you as an expert in your field. It provides tangible value that encourages users to “Save” your post—a high-weight engagement metric for the algorithm.

  • How-To Tutorials: Break down a complex process into 5-7 simple steps using a carousel post.
  • Industry Myth-Busting: Identify common misconceptions in your niche and explain why they are wrong.
  • Top Tools/Resources: Share a list of apps or websites that help you stay productive or achieve results.
  • Quick Tips & Hacks: Use a 15-second Reel to share a “hidden” feature or a shortcut your audience might not know.
  • The “Aha!” Moment: Explain a concept that changed your perspective on your industry.

2. The “Inspirational” Content Pillar

Inspiration builds an emotional connection with your audience. It makes your brand relatable and human.

  • Behind-the-Scenes (BTS): Show the “messy” reality of your workspace or your daily routine. People love seeing the process, not just the finished product.
  • Your “Why”: Share the story of why you started your journey. Vulnerability often leads to high social media engagement.
  • Quotes with a Twist: Instead of generic quotes, share a quote that resonates with your specific brand values and add a long, thoughtful caption.
  • Transformation Stories: Show a “Before and After” of a project, a habit, or a business milestone.
  • Client Success Stories: Highlight how your advice or product helped someone else achieve their goals.

3. The “Entertaining” Content Pillar

Entertainment is the primary reason most people use Instagram. If you can make your audience laugh or smile, they are more likely to remember you.

  • Relatable Memes: Create or adapt memes that speak to the specific struggles of your audience.
  • Trending Audios: Use trending hashtags and popular music on Reels to participate in viral challenges (while keeping it relevant to your brand).
  • “Day in the Life” Vlogs: Use fast-paced editing to show a snippet of your day.
  • Mistakes & Bloopers: Sharing your failures makes you more approachable and authentic.
  • Interactive Polls: Use the “Poll” or “Slider” stickers in Instagram stories to ask fun, non-business questions.

4. The “Promotional” Content Pillar

While you shouldn’t sell in every post, you must let people know how they can work with you or buy from you.

  • Product Teasers: Show a close-up or a “sneak peek” of something you are working on.
  • User-Generated Content (UGC): Repost content from your customers or followers using your product. User-generated content acts as powerful social proof.
  • Limited Time Offers: Create a sense of urgency with a countdown timer in your Stories.
  • Service Breakdown: Explicitly explain what your service includes and who it is for.
  • FAQ Sessions: Answer common questions about your products or services in a dedicated “Highlights” section.

Phase 3: Mastering Instagram Formats

To maximize your reach, you must understand the technical nuances of each format. A creative Instagram content idea can fail if it is presented in the wrong format.

Maximizing Instagram Reels

Reels are currently the best way to gain “organic reach” (reaching people who don’t follow you yet). Focus on the first 3 seconds—the “Hook.” You must grab attention immediately through text on screen or a compelling visual movement.

The Power of Carousels

Carousels (up to 10 slides) are the best format for visual storytelling. Because users have to swipe to see the whole post, the algorithm sees this as high engagement. Use the first slide for a bold headline and the last slide for a clear Call to Action (CTA).

Engaging with Instagram Stories

Stories are where you build a loyal community. Use them to show your face, talk directly to the camera, and use interactive stickers. This is the place for “low-production” content that feels raw and real.

Phase 4: Creating a Sustainable Content Calendar

The biggest mistake beginners make is posting sporadically. Consistency is the backbone of any successful Instagram marketing strategy. You do not need to post every day, but you should have a predictable schedule.

Step 1: Choose Your Frequency. Can you realistically commit to 3 posts per week? Start there. Quality always beats quantity.

Step 2: Batch Your Content. Instead of creating content every day, dedicate one day a week to filming and writing all your posts. This prevents burnout.

Step 3: Use a Content Calendar. Use tools like Notion, Trello, or Google Calendar to map out your topics for the month. This ensures a healthy mix of your content pillars.

Essential Tools for Instagram Beginners

You do not need expensive equipment to create high-quality content. Your smartphone is more than enough. However, a few apps can elevate your brand aesthetic:

  • Canva: Perfect for designing carousels and story templates without graphic design skills.
  • CapCut: An intuitive mobile video editor for creating professional-looking Reels.
  • Lightroom Mobile: For consistent photo editing and color grading.
  • AnswerThePublic: A great tool for finding what questions people are asking about your niche to generate creative Instagram content ideas.
  • Meta Business Suite: For scheduling your posts in advance for free.
